Gå til innhold

CSS: Margin som ikke skal være der?


Anbefalte innlegg

Hei.

 

<div id="container">
<img src="gfx/header.png" alt="Murr" />

<div id="navigasjon">Navigasjon.</div>

<div id="innhold">Her skulle det egentlig stått noe fryktelig artig.</div>
</div>

 

body {
   margin: 0px;
   padding: 0px;
}

html {
   font-family: Verdana, sans-serif;
   font-size: 12px;
   background: url("gfx/bakgrunn.png");
}

#container {
   width: 482px;
   margin: 0 auto;
}

#container img {
   border-color: #000000;
   border-width: 1px;
   border-top-width: 0px;
   border-style: solid;
   margin-bottom: 0px;
}

#container div {
   padding: 2px;
}

#navigasjon {
   border-width: 1px;
   border-style: solid;
   border-color: #000000;
   background-color: #FFFFFF;
   text-align: center;
   margin-top: 0px;
}

#navigasjon a {
   color: #000000;
}

#navigasjon a:hover {
   background-color: #000000;
   color: #FFFFFF;
}

#innhold {
   border: 1px solid #000000;
   background-color: #FFFFFF;
   margin-top: 0px;
}

 

Problemet er at jeg får mellomrom mellom navigasjon og header, selv om begge har 0px margin. Hvorfor? :blush:

Lenke til kommentar
Videoannonse
Annonse

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
×
×
  • Opprett ny...